Noun [Proto-Germanic]

Etymology: Ascribed to a Proto-Indo-European root *h₂uk-, *h₂ewk- (“a closed container or vessel for cooking; cookpot; oven”) or similar by equation with Sanskrit उखा (ukhā), Albanian anë, Ancient Greek ἰπνός (ipnós), Latin ōlla. It is unclear whether the byform *ufnaz (Proto-West Germanic *ofn) is the same word, or represents a different word altogether. Kroonen suggests that the word is a Wanderwort from a pre-IE substrate language. Native terms for ovens and stoves are not taken for granted: the East Slavic term плита́ (plitá, “stove”) appears from Ancient Greek in the Middle Ages, against the earlier new formation печь (pečʹ, “oven”), and Arabic, in a warmer climate, seems to have many but no native terms: أَتُّون (ʔattūn), تَنُّور (tannūr), فُرْن (furn), قَمِين (qamīn).
